Steel shaft can be produced as solid body or circular tube with circular tube. The shaft must bear a torque of 1200 Nm. Since the shear strength for the shaft material is 40 MPa, the maximum allowable unit torsion angle of the bar is 0.75 ^ 0 / m and the shear modulus of steel is G = 78 GPa; a) Find the required diameter d0 for a solid circle shaft. b) Find the required outside diameter d2 for a ring-section shaft whose thickness is one tenth of the outer diameter. c) Find the diameter ratio (d2 / d0 ratio) and weight ratio for ring cross section and solid section shafts
